Easy 20 Minute Butter Chicken: A Flavorful Homemade Delight

July 24, 2025
Easy 20 Minute Butter Chicken

Introduction to Easy 20 Minute Butter Chicken

If you’re on the lookout for a dish that combines comfort, flavor, and speed, look no further than easy 20 minute butter chicken. This Indian-inspired delight is not only a crowd-pleaser but also a stress-reliever on busy weeknights. Imagine tender chicken pieces simmered in a creamy, spiced tomato sauce—all done in just twenty minutes. Perfect for young professionals juggling work, life, and social engagements!

Why is Butter Chicken the Ultimate Comfort Food?

Butter chicken has earned its title as the ultimate comfort food for several reasons. First off, the marriage of rich flavors—think buttery, creamy, and spiced—creates a taste sensation that warms the soul. According to a survey by Mintel, comfort food is often tied to nostalgia, and for many, butter chicken evokes fond memories of shared meals with loved ones.

Furthermore, it’s incredibly versatile. You can pair it with rice, naan, or even a fresh salad, allowing you to customize your meal effortlessly. This flexibility makes it ideal for various dietary preferences, whether you’re leaning towards low-carb options or simply craving some starchy goodness.

Another reason for its comfort food status? The balance of spices! The ingredients often include garam masala, turmeric, and ginger, all of which not only add deliciousness but may also offer health benefits. Studies suggest that turmeric, for example, possesses anti-inflammatory properties. You’re not just indulging; you’re also nurturing yourself.

As a personal touch, I remember my first attempt at making butter chicken. I was stressed and short for time. But the moment I took that first bite of my homemade version, it was like a warm hug—comfort on a plate. This easy 20 minute butter chicken recipe ensures that whether it’s a hectic Tuesday evening or a calming Sunday, you can whip up a meal that brings joy to your table without requiring hours of prep.

Ready to dive into this quick and delicious experience? Let’s get cooking!

Ingredients for Easy 20 Minute Butter Chicken

Essential ingredients for butter chicken

To whip up a delicious easy 20 minute butter chicken, you’ll need a few essential ingredients that pack a flavorful punch:

  • Chicken: Boneless, skinless chicken thighs or breasts work well—just cut them into bite-sized pieces.
  • Butter: This is the star of the dish! It adds rich creaminess and enhances the flavor.
  • Tomato sauce: A smooth blend of crushed tomatoes or passata gives an authentic touch.
  • Heavy cream: For that signature rich and silky texture.
  • Garlic and ginger: Fresh or pre-made, these add warmth and depth.
  • Spices: Don’t skimp on garam masala, cumin, and chili powder. They create that classic Indian flavor profile.
  • Cilantro: A sprinkle of fresh cilantro elevates the dish with freshness.

Recommended substitutes

Life can be unpredictable, and sometimes you may need substitutes. Here’s what you can use without sacrificing flavor:

  • Chicken: Use turkey or plant-based chicken alternatives if desired.
  • Heavy cream: Swap for coconut milk for a dairy-free option without losing creaminess.
  • Tomato sauce: Canned tomato soup can offer a quicker alternative.
  • Garam masala: If you don’t have this, a mix of ground spices like cinnamon and coriander can work in a pinch.

For more on the benefits of these substitutes, check out resources from Healthline or Epicurious.

With these ingredients in hand, you’re ready to embrace the kitchen and create a mouthwatering dish in no time!

Step-by-Step Preparation of Easy 20 Minute Butter Chicken

Getting a delicious meal on the table in just 20 minutes sounds almost too good to be true, right? This easy 20 minute butter chicken recipe is not only quick but also bursting with flavor. Let’s dive into how you can prepare this sumptuous dish in a snap!

Gather and Prep Your Ingredients

Before the fun begins, make sure you have all your ingredients ready. Here’s what you’ll need:

  • Chicken Breasts: About 1 pound, diced into bite-sized pieces.
  • Butter: 3 tablespoons for ultimate creaminess.
  • Cooking Oil: 1 tablespoon of vegetable or olive oil for frying.
  • Onion: 1 medium, finely chopped.
  • Garlic and Ginger: 2 cloves of garlic and 1 tablespoon of freshly grated ginger, minced.
  • Spices: Don’t forget the garam masala, turmeric, cumin, and chili powder for that authentic taste.
  • Tomato Puree: 1 cup for a rich, tangy base.
  • Cream: 1/2 cup heavy cream for the sauce’s luscious texture.
  • Salt and Pepper: To taste.

Having everything prepped and measured will streamline your cooking process, reducing the chance of kitchen chaos. Pro tip: You can find helpful cooking guides on websites like Serious Eats or BBC Good Food for inspiration.

Marinate the Chicken (Optional for Quick Meals)

Here’s a secret: marinating your chicken can really enhance the flavor, but if you’re pressed for time, you can skip this step. If you opt to marinate, do the following:

  • Mix a tablespoon of yogurt with some spices (like a pinch of garam masala, turmeric, and salt).
  • Combine with the diced chicken and let it sit for about 15-20 minutes while you gather your ingredients.

This brief marination infuses your chicken with flavor—perfect for impressing guests or simply indulging yourself!

Cook the Chicken for Optimal Flavor

In a large, heavy-bottom skillet over medium-high heat, heat the oil and melt 2 tablespoons of butter. Once it’s hot, add the chopped onions and sauté until they’re translucent. This usually takes about 3 minutes. The aroma? Incredible already!

  • Add in garlic and ginger and cook for another minute until fragrant.
  • Toss in the marinated chicken (or plain if you opted to skip the marinade) and cook for about 5-7 minutes. Ensure the chicken is browned nicely; this will add depth to the overall flavor.

Keeping it on medium-high heat will help achieve a beautiful sear on your chicken while locking in moisture.

Prepare the Creamy Butter Sauce

Once the chicken is cooked through, it’s time to create that dreamy butter sauce which makes this an easy 20 minute butter chicken dish.

  • Add the tomato puree and let it simmer for about 3-4 minutes. This cooks out the raw taste and allows the flavors to meld together.
  • Stir in the remaining butter, the spices (garam masala, cumin, turmeric, and chili powder), and season with salt and pepper. The sauce should have a slightly thicker consistency and a vibrant color—simply divine.

Combine and Simmer for Deliciousness

Now, the pièce de résistance! Reduce the heat to medium-low and slowly pour in the heavy cream, stirring gently to incorporate everything. Let it simmer for another 2-3 minutes.

  • Taste and adjust seasoning if necessary. You can also add a splash of water if the sauce appears too thick.
  • Serve hot with fluffy basmati rice or warm naan for a perfect meal.

And voila! Your easy 20 minute butter chicken is ready to be devoured. Not only is this dish quick, but it is also rich and inviting—a great way to wind down after a busy day. Trust us, you’ll be glad you whipped this up!

Variations of Easy 20 Minute Butter Chicken

Butter Chicken with Vegetables

If you’re looking to add some nutrition to your easy 20 minute butter chicken, incorporating vegetables is a fantastic way to do it. Not only do they boost the dish’s flavor, but they also make it more colorful and satisfying. Consider adding:

  • Bell Peppers: These add a sweet crunch and vibrant color.
  • Spinach: A handful of fresh spinach tossed in just before serving enhances the dish with nutrients and brightens the flavor.
  • Zucchini: Sliced thinly, it cooks quickly and complements the rich sauce beautifully.

To keep this variation quick, simply sauté your chosen veggies for a few minutes before adding the chicken and sauce. Not only will you be delighted by the result, but your taste buds will thank you for the added texture and flavor!

Spicy Butter Chicken for Heat Lovers

Craving a kick in your easy 20 minute butter chicken? Spice it up! Elevating your dish with heat can transform your mealtime into an adventurous experience. Here’s how you can turn it up:

  • Extra Chili Powder or Cayenne: Add a teaspoon or more, depending on your heat tolerance.
  • Green Chilies: Chopped and stirred into the sauce add authenticity and a vibrant punch.
  • Ginger and Garlic: Increase the amounts of fresh ginger and garlic for that deep, aromatic warmth.

For those ready to explore the world of spicy cuisine, you might find inspiration in articles from The Spruce Eats or Bon Appétit. Playing around with spice levels can lead to a customized culinary experience that’s unique to you!

Enjoy experimenting with these variations and let your easy 20 minute butter chicken shine in new and exciting of flavors. Happy cooking!

Cooking Tips and Notes for Easy 20 Minute Butter Chicken

Essential cooking techniques

To whip up this easy 20 minute butter chicken, mastering a few simple techniques is key.

  • Sautéing: Start by sautéing your onions and garlic in ghee or butter until fragrant. This not only builds flavor but also creates a rich base for your sauce.
  • Timing: If you’re using frozen chicken, make sure to cut it into smaller pieces for even cooking and quicker thawing. Fresh chicken usually cooks faster, so perfect timing is your ally!

For valuable insights on cooking chicken perfectly, check out the USDA’s cooking guidelines.

Common mistakes to avoid

Even a quick recipe can go wrong! Here are common mistakes to watch out for:

  • Overcooking the chicken: This can lead to dry, chewy bites. Always aim for tender, juicy chicken.
  • Not seasoning enough: The magic of this dish comes from the spices. Don’t shy away from garlic, ginger, and garam masala!
  • Ignoring texture: A smooth sauce is essential. Use a blender for consistency if needed.

By avoiding these pitfalls, you’ll elevate your cooking and enjoy an exceptionally tasting easy 20 minute butter chicken!

Serving Suggestions for Easy 20 Minute Butter Chicken

Best sides to complement butter chicken

Pairing your easy 20 minute butter chicken with the right sides can elevate this dish from delicious to unforgettable. Here are a couple of classic favorites:

  • Basmati Rice: Fluffy and aromatic, it’s perfect for soaking up the rich sauce.
  • Naan Bread: Freshly baked or store-bought, naan is ideal for scooping up every last bit of your buttery sauce.
  • Saag Paneer: Spinach and cheese create a vibrant color contrast and a wonderful flavor combination.

For extra crunch, consider adding a side of cucumber raita. This cooling yogurt-based dish can balance the spices beautifully.

Creative serving ideas

When it comes to serving your easy 20 minute butter chicken, think beyond the plate! Here are some fun variations:

  • Wrap it up: Use naan or tortillas to make flavorful wraps with leftover chicken.
  • Rice Bowls: Layer butter chicken with rice, fresh veggies, and a sprinkle of herbs for a colorful bowl.
  • Party bites: Cut the chicken into small pieces and serve it on skewers for an appetizer-style option.

These alternatives not only enhance your meal but also make leftovers exciting! If you’re looking for more creative ideas, check out this article on quick Indian meals. Enjoy your cooking adventure!

Time Breakdown for Easy 20 Minute Butter Chicken

Navigating a busy lifestyle can make cooking feel overwhelming, but our easy 20 minute butter chicken recipe is your ticket to a satisfying meal in no time!

Prep Time

In just 5 minutes, you’ll gather your ingredients and chop any necessary veggies. Quick tip: keeping chicken breast prepped in your fridge helps speed things up even further!

Cooking Time

The real magic happens during the 15-minute cooking phase. This is where you’ll sauté everything to perfection, creating a rich, creamy sauce that’ll have you wondering how it was ever this simple.

Total Time

In just 20 minutes, you can have a delicious meal ready to go! Whether you’re serving it over rice or with warm naan, this dish is perfect for busy weeknights. For more culinary inspiration, check out BBC Good Food for similar quick recipes that won’t break the bank or your schedule.

Now, let’s dig into the recipe itself!

Nutritional Facts for Easy 20 Minute Butter Chicken

Calories

When it comes to keeping your meals balanced, knowing the calories in your dishes is essential. This easy 20 minute butter chicken packs approximately 360 calories per serving. It’s hearty yet fitting for a busy weeknight dinner!

Protein

Craving something that fuels your body? Each serving of this butter chicken delivers around 25 grams of protein. Perfect for those looking to support muscle repair and keep energy levels high throughout the day.

Carb Count

Worried about carbs? This dish contains about 15 grams of carbohydrates per serving. It’s an excellent choice if you’re looking to enjoy your meal without derailing your dietary goals. Paired with some veggies, it can fit seamlessly into a balanced diet.

If you’re curious about the nutritional breakdown of other common recipes or need guidance on meal planning, check out resources like the USDA FoodData Central for more detailed information. Enjoy cooking and savoring your delicious creations!

FAQs about Easy 20 Minute Butter Chicken

Can I make butter chicken without cream?
Absolutely! If you want to skip the cream but still crave that rich flavor, consider using coconut milk or cashew cream as a substitute. Both options maintain that delicious texture without the dairy. Just remember, using coconut milk will add a slight sweetness, so you might need to adjust your spices to balance it out.

What can I use in place of chicken?
For those looking for a meat alternative in this easy 20 minute butter chicken, you have plenty of options! Tofu is a popular choice since it absorbs flavors well. If you prefer something heartier, chickpeas or even mushrooms can make excellent substitutes. Both options not only enhance the dish but also keep it plant-based and satisfying.

How long does leftover butter chicken last?
Leftover butter chicken can be a lifesaver for busy weeks! Stored properly in an airtight container, it typically lasts in the refrigerator for about 3 to 4 days. You can also freeze it for up to 3 months if you want to meal prep. To reheat, simply warm it on the stove or in the microwave until heated through. Just be careful not to overcook it, as it can dry out.

For more cooking tips and techniques, check out Serious Eats and elevate your culinary skills. If you’re looking for ways to incorporate your leftovers into future meals, visit ChefSteps for creative inspiration. Enjoy your cooking adventure!

Conclusion on Easy 20 Minute Butter Chicken

Why you’ll keep coming back to this recipe

After trying this easy 20 minute butter chicken, you’ll quickly realize why it has become a staple in many kitchens. Not only is it a fast and satisfying dish, but its rich, creamy flavors make it truly irresistible.

Preparing this meal saves time without sacrificing taste, making it perfect for busy weeknights. Plus, with the addition of simple ingredients like tomato puree and spices, it’s adaptable for different dietary needs.

Whether you whip it up for a cozy dinner or serve it at a casual gathering, this butter chicken will impress your guests. Explore more tips and variations to make it truly your own!

Print

Easy 20 Minute Butter Chicken: A Flavorful Homemade Delight

A quick and easy recipe for a delicious butter chicken that you can make in just 20 minutes!

  • Author: Souzan
  • Prep Time: 5 minutes
  • Cook Time: 15 minutes
  • Total Time: 20 minutes
  • Yield: 4 servings 1x
  • Category: Dinner
  • Method: Stovetop
  • Cuisine: Indian
  • Diet: Gluten-Free

Ingredients

Scale
  • 1 pound boneless chicken breasts
  • 2 tablespoons butter
  • 1 cup heavy cream
  • 1/2 cup tomato sauce
  • 2 tablespoons garam masala
  • 1 tablespoon garlic, minced
  • 1 teaspoon salt
  • 1 tablespoon fresh cilantro, chopped

Instructions

  1. Cut the chicken into bite-size pieces.
  2. In a skillet, melt the butter over medium heat.
  3. Add the chicken and cook until browned.
  4. Stir in garlic and garam masala, cooking for 1 minute.
  5. Add tomato sauce and cream, simmer for 5 minutes.
  6. Season with salt and garnish with cilantro before serving.

Notes

  • This dish pairs well with rice or naan.
  • Adjust the spices according to your preference.

Nutrition

  • Serving Size: 1 cup
  • Calories: 400
  • Sugar: 2 grams
  • Sodium: 800 milligrams
  • Fat: 35 grams
  • Saturated Fat: 20 grams
  • Unsaturated Fat: 10 grams
  • Trans Fat: 0 grams
  • Carbohydrates: 8 grams
  • Fiber: 1 gram
  • Protein: 25 grams
  • Cholesterol: 100 milligrams

Keywords: easy butter chicken, quick butter chicken, 20 minute recipe

Did you make this recipe?

Share a photo and tag us — we can't wait to see what you've made!

More Posts

Leave a Comment

Recipe rating